ADVICE

Audio Starts Automatically

  • You cannot start, stop, or slow the listening audio; it plays automatically on both paper and computer exams.
  • Use the 30 seconds before each section to highlight keywords and make predictions before the audio begins.
ADVICE

Use All Caps To Avoid Capitalization Errors

  • Most computer test centers allow caps lock and typing in ALL CAPS is permitted on IELTS answers.
  • Use all caps to avoid capitalization errors, but practice first because it can slow your typing speed in the written test.
ADVICE

Write Phonetically And Fix Later

  • If a word's spelling stalls you during the audio, write a quick phonetic version or best-guess spelling and move on immediately.
  • Rely on the time after sections to correct spelling so you don't miss subsequent answers.
